SET INTERFACE EXTERNALPROFILE
Syntax
SET INTERFACE={ type: | type:id-range | id-range | ifname-list |
ALL }
EXTERNALPROFILE={ profile | NONE }
Description Supports the specification of an external profile name on an interface. When the Allied-
View NMS sets the port attributes by deploying an NMS profile, the
SHOW INTERFACE
command on the product displays the NMS profile name that has been applied as an
External Profile name. Moreover, if at the NMS a port is deprovisioned, the product
output for External Profile is set to None.
When the SBx3112 is managed by the NMS, this command should not be used.
Options The following table gives the range of values for each option that can be specified with
this command and a default value (if applicable).
Example SET INTERFACE=8.* EXTERNALPROFILE=GE24POE_ClassA
